Factors

Brewing Time

Brewing time should be about 6 minutes for 8 cups of coffee. This will allow for proper water flow and saturation time. 

Brewing Temperature

The coffee industry’s standard for the temperature of the brewing water is 195°- 205°F (91°-96°C). This coffee brewer is engineered to heat the water to precisely this range.

Water

For ideal extraction levels, brew your coffee in 6-8 cup batches. Brew with fresh, filtered water whenever possible.

Coffee Bean

The quality of the coffee has a great impact on brewed coffee’s favor. Using freshly roasted coffee and grinding the beans just before brewing are important considerations. We recommend using coffee within a couple of weeks of its roast date. Air tight storage will help extend your coffee’s lifespan.

Grinding Coffee

Grinding coffee is another key point on the timeline of  avor and perishability. Once coffee is ground the air begins to attack essential oils and other volatile  avor components. It’s only a matter of hours before most of the ground coffee’s aroma has evaporated. Sometimes pre-grinding can’t be avoided, but if it can, put it off until shortly before brewing.

Ratio

If you always use the same ratio of water to coffee grounds, the favor of your coffee will be more consistent. We recommend 2 tbsp of drip-ground coffee per 5 oz cup. If you wanted to brew 6 cups (30oz) try adding 12 tbsp (60g) of coffee. If weight is more your thing using a ratio of 1 oz. of coffee to 15  . oz. of water as a good starting point. Feel free to use more or less coffee to suit your taste.

Clean

Keep the filter basket, water tank, and carafe clean.
